Abdavark “Shrinking Stage” is a game I made that is inspired by the Steam game Windowkill (which I have never played - I don’t even have a Steam account - but I have seen YouTube videos of it). Shrinking Stage10kB Instructions Click to reveal Click to hide Move your mouse to rotate your player and aim and dodge. If the controls do not work, turn off “disable touchpad/mouse while typing” in your system settings. Use [W] to move your player and avoid enemy shots. Use Space to shoot at enemies to defeat them, at powerups to collect them, or at the border of the stage to expand it.
